Compare the rivalry schools - The College of Health Care Professions-Northwest and The Art Institute of Houston.

The College of Health Care Professions-Northwest is a Private, 4-years school located in Houston, TX and The Art Institute of Houston is a Private, 4-years school located in Houston, TX. Following list and table compares two rivalry schools in various academic factors.
  • The College of Health Care Professions-Northwest (3,201 students) is larger than The Art Institute of Houston (317 students).
  • The Art Institute of Houston has more expensive tuition & fees of $20,794 than The College of Health Care Professions-Northwest($19,800).
  • The College of Health Care Professions-Northwest has more full-time faculties of 48 faculties than The Art Institute of Houston(7 facluties).
